December 13 (SeeNews) - Bosnian marketing agency Masta, owned by Sarajevo-based foundation Mozaik, has acquired an 11.2% stake in local investment fund Prof Plus for 2 million marka ($1.2 million/1 million euro), local media reported.
Masta purchased 568,400 shares in Prof Plus in a total of seven transactions on the Sarajevo Stock Exchange on December 6, news provider Indikator reported on Saturday.

Masta bought the shares at an average price of 3.57 marka apiece, bourse data showed.
The marketing agency is currently the fourth largest shareholder in Prof Plus, following investment fund BIG-Investiciona Grupa with a 24.98% stake, furniture maker Naprijed with 14.86% and investment fund Crobih with 13.05%.
(1 euro = 1.95583 marka)
